Method and device for controlling motor vehicle cornering velocity
DRIVE
September 18, 2002
The method involves determining the transverse acceleration and actual vehicle speed, determining the yaw rate, determining the float angle from the transverse acceleration, yaw rate and actual speed, comparing the float angle with a defined threshold and intervening in the control if there is a deviation. Independent claims are also included for the following: an arrangement for regulating vehicle speed in bends.
